Good morning folks,
We've had some lively discussions regarding the best ways to measure
scrap within a manufacturing operation. What are some common ways of
characterizing and measuring accurate scrap levels?
Also, I know this next one is a loaded question but I'll fire it off
anyway. When scrap is measured as a percentage of sales, what values are
typical within this industry? One percent? Five percent? Is there a
significant difference between the value one would anticipate for a
board fab shop versus an assembly operation?
